Why is more apropriate to write
if(true == a)
instead of
if(a == true)
and why the
if(a)
is avoidable. I mean not avoidable, but the first two are preferable.
|
|
|
|
|
TCPMem wrote: if(true == a)
because if you type "=" instead of "==" the compiler will report an error.

They are all largely a matter of style, although option 1 tends not to be used in C++ as most modern compilers tend to query expressions of the form:
if (a = true)
on the basis that it is probably a typo. The last form is quite acceptable although once again things have moved on with C++ and a might not be a bool type.
